High Rate of Children Returning to Out-of-Home Care in Netherlands

A Leiden University study found that 40% of children placed in out-of-home care in 2018 returned home by 2023, with 25% experiencing a second placement; staff shortages, parental trauma, and frequent child moves contribute to this high rate of re-placement, impacting children's mental health.

Dutch Authority Warns of AI Chatbot Dangers

The Dutch Data Protection Authority warns of the dangers of AI chatbots for mental health, citing privacy concerns and inadequate responses to distress signals in four example conversations. The EU's AI Act will require disclosure of AI use by mid-2026.

EU Threatens Legal Action Against Netherlands Over NS Rail Concession

The European Commission threatens legal action against the Netherlands for granting the NS exclusive rights to operate main rail lines without an open tender, violating EU rules and prompting complaints from other railway operators. The Netherlands has two months to comply or face legal proceedings.

Milieudefensie Appeals to Netherlands Supreme Court to Force Shell to Halve CO2 Emissions

Milieudefensie is appealing to the Netherlands Supreme Court to force Shell to halve its CO2 emissions by 2030, following a lower court victory overturned by an appeals court that argued setting a precise emission reduction percentage is unfeasible.

€250,000 Reward Offered for Stolen Romanian Artifacts

In Assen, Netherlands, thieves stole a priceless gold helmet and three armbands from the Drents Museum on January 24-25, 2024; the items, on loan from Romania, are valued at €5.8 million, with a €250,000 reward offered for their return.

\"Netherlands Lags in Tech Innovation Amidst Strict Regulations and Funding Shortfalls\"\

Due to stringent regulations and reduced funding, the Netherlands is experiencing a decline in tech startups, falling behind nations like the US in AI and innovation, with the number of new startups decreasing from 197 in 2023 to 128 in 2024.

Almere Municipality and NTA Dispute Over Mosque Investigation

The Amsterdam Metropolitan Area Ombudsman criticized Almere municipality for using private investigator NTA to research extremism in Muslim communities, while NTA denies infiltration and demands a retraction; the municipality apologized.
